The copper-based (Cu-based) halide perovskite possesses eco-friendly features, bright self-trapped-exciton (broadband) emission, and a high color-rendering index (CRI) for achieving white emission. However, the limited hole injection (HI) of Cu-based perovskites has been bottle-necking the efficiency of white electroluminescence and thus their application in white perovskite light-emitting diodes (W-PeLEDs).
